'FileNotFoundError' in running nepal.fwd.py #93

I tried the example project of Nepal earthquake shown by the wiki, but got error:
A simple forward computation

error:

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/home/xxxx/test/forward_modeling/nepal.fwd.py", line 73, in <module>
  runslip.make_green(home,project_name,station_file,fault_name,model_name,
File "/home/xxxx/MudPy/src/python/mudpy/runslip.py", line 169, in make_green
  copy('staticgf',green_path+'static/'+model_name+'.static.'+strdepth+'.sub'+subfault)
File "/home/xxxx/miniconda3/lib/python3.9/shutil.py", line 427, in copy
   copyfile(src, dst, follow_symlinks=follow_symlinks)
File "/home/xxxx/miniconda3/lib/python3.9/shutil.py", line 264, in copyfile
    with open(src, 'rb') as fsrc:
FileNotFoundError: [Errno 2] No such file or directory: 'staticgf'

This error is resolved by replacing the tsunami flag in nepal.fwd.py from 'tsunami=None' to 'tsunami=False'.
